Sachein,
the
2005-released
romantic
comedy
still
remains
as
one
of
the
most-loved
films
in
Vijay's
acting
career.
Vijay
made
a
comeback
to
his
boy
next
door
avathar
after
a
series
of
action
roles,
with
Sachein.
The
actor
essayed
the
titular
character
in
the
movie,
which
was
written
and
directed
by
John
Mahendran.
Genelia
D'souza
essayed
the
female
lead
opposite
Vijay
in
the
movie,
which
marked
the
Tamil
debut
of
renowned
Bollywood
actress
Bipasha
Basu.

Sachein
was
loosely
based
on
the
2002-released
Telugu
movie
Neetho,
which
was
directed
by
director
John
Mahendran
himself.
Neetho,
which
featured
Prakash
Kovelamudi
and
Mahek
Chahal,
was
a
critical
and
commerical
failure.
However,
Sachein,
which
was
released
alongside
the
Rajinikanth
and
Kamal
Haasan
starring
biggies
Chandramukhi
and
Mumbai
Express,
opened
to
postivie
reviews
and
emerged
as
a
decent
success
at
the
Tamil
Nadu
box
office.
The
songs,
which
were
composed
by
renowned
musician
Devi
Sri
Prasad
had
become
instant
chartbusters.
Late.
cinematographer
Jeeva
had
handled
the
direction
of
photography
of
Sachein,
which
was
produced
by
Kalaipuli
S
Dhanu
for
V
Creations.
